AMGA selects 3 new board members

The AMGA, which represents medical groups and integrated healthcare systems, added three members to its board of directors.

Advertisement

The new members beginning their tenure in January 2017 are:

•    Mark DeRubeis, MBA, CEO of Monroeville, Pa.-based Premier Medical Associates
•    Shane Peng, MD, president of physician and ambulatory services at St. Louis-based SSM Health
•    Larry Tatum, MD, CEO of Privia Medical Group-North Texas, part of Arlington, Va.-based Privia Health.

The trade association’s current chair is Donn E. Sorensen, MBA, president of St. Louis-based Mercy’s East Region and the chair-elect is Ashok Rai, MD, president and CEO of Green Bay, Wis.-based Prevea Health.
